logo

Output 9501c3742811a20f98f26cabefec2a832868c668296f314ccce515582f6d3f53:15

value
9879618
script pubkey
OP_0 OP_PUSHBYTES_20 88ef2498e7c7c6b48ab46d02314d937cd619d15a
address
bc1q3rhjfx88clrtfz45d5prznvn0ntpn526nz4xy2
transaction
9501c3742811a20f98f26cabefec2a832868c668296f314ccce515582f6d3f53